Problem

Software as a Medical Device (SaMD) and AI-driven medical technologies face complex regulatory pathways, particularly in the EU, leading to delays in market access. Navigating the EU Medical Device Regulation (MDR) and the upcoming AI Act requires specialized expertise, which can be a significant hurdle for manufacturers.

Solution

Scarlet provides specialized certification services for Software as a Medical Device (SaMD) and AI-driven medical technologies, acting as a Notified Body focused on these areas. The company streamlines the regulatory approval process, enabling manufacturers to achieve predictable and continuous market access for their innovations in the European Union. Scarlet offers a certification process tailored for software and AI, helping manufacturers navigate the complexities of MDR and the AI Act. By ensuring compliance with EU regulations, Scarlet reduces delays in bringing life-changing healthcare solutions to patients.

Target Audience

The primary customers are manufacturers of Software as a Medical Device (SaMD) and AI-driven medical technologies seeking regulatory approval and market access in the European Union.
